What are UPVC Doors and Windows?
UPVC represents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ride, a rigid and extremely long lasting kind of plastic. UPVC windows and doors are produced from this product, making them resistant to weather, rot, and deterioration. They are understood for their excellent thermal insulation homes, low upkeep requirements, and cost-effectiveness.
Advantages of UPVC Doors and Windows
Durability: UPVC is resistant to rain, sunshine, and pollution. Unlike lumber, which can warp or rot gradually, UPVC maintains its shape and structure without deteriorating.
Energy Efficiency: UPVC doors and windows offer remarkable insulation, lowering heat loss and resulting in lower energy expenses. Lots of modern-day UPVC products are developed to meet energy performance requirements such as Energy Star rankings.
Low Maintenance: Unlike painted surfaces that require routine upkeep, UPVC requires very little upkeep. An easy wash with soap and water is typically adequate to keep these components looking new.
Security: UPVC doors and windows can be created with multi-point locking systems, supplying included security for homeowners.
Versatility in Design: UPVC frames can be customized to suit different architectural designs and can be manufactured in different colors, sizes, and surfaces.

Features of UPVC Doors and Windows
UPVC doors and windows featured a number of functions that boost their functionality and visual appeal:
Double Glazing: Many UPVC products include double or even triple glazing, enhancing thermal insulation and noise reduction.
Multi-Point Locking: This feature improves security by locking at numerous points along the frame, making it difficult for intruders to get.
Customization: Homeowners can pick from various designs, colors, and completes to fit a large range of architectural designs.
Weather condition Resistance: UPVC is invulnerable to wetness and does not swell or shrink, making it an exceptional choice for homes in locations that experience extreme weather.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Are UPVC doors and windows environmentally friendly?
- UPVC can be recycled, and lots of producers concentrate on sustainable practices when producing these products. Nevertheless, the overall ecological effect depends on the lifecycle of the product and how it's handled at the end of its life period.
2. The length of time do UPVC doors and windows last?
- With correct care and upkeep, UPVC doors and windows can last anywhere from 20 to 40 years.
3. Can UPVC windows be painted?
- While it is possible to paint UPVC, it is not advised, as it might void warranties and impact the surface finish gradually. Instead, homeowners can select from a variety of colors offered at the point of purchase.
4. What is the typical cost of UPVC windows and doors?
- The price might differ extensively based upon size, design, and installation specifics. Usually, UPVC doors and windows are priced competitively, using good value for their durability and energy efficiency.
5. Are UPVC windows suitable for seaside areas?
- Yes, UPVC is highly resistant to saltwater rust, making it a perfect choice for homes near the ocean.
Maintenance Tips for UPVC Doors and Windows
To guarantee the durability and performance of UPVC doors and windows, house owners should follow these upkeep ideas:
Regular Cleaning: Use moderate soapy water and a soft cloth to clean the frames and glazing a minimum of twice a year.
Check Seals: Inspect the rubber seals routinely and change them if there are indications of wear to maintain energy performance.
Lubricate Handles and Locks: Occasional lubrication of deals with and locks helps guarantee smooth operation and avoids rust or corrosion.
Inspect for Damage: Regularly examine the frames for any fractures or indications of damage and seek expert help for repair work as required.
